Draft: Remove all nicks and blurbs from param specs

Open Sophie Herold requested to merge wip/sophie-h/remove-nick-blurb into main

Nicks and blurbs don't have any practical use for gio/gobject libraries. Leaving tests untouched since this features is still used by other libraries.

Closes #2991

Merge request reports